Public House. Early C19 with C20 addition. Whitewashed stone rubble with slate roof
gabled at ends and gable end stone stacks with moulded caps. 2-room plan with
central entrance. 2 storeys. Gothick style with a symmetrical 3-bay front with
a central gabled stone porch. Arched 3-light windows have intersecting glazing bars,
2 first floor windows have replaced glazing bars.
Interior modernized.
